Output 85587c25cb2095b9a1ce53fb5810944b8c6be4dcf23ba3dcd91fc589b14af965:1

value
68180469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06a0e5560b8219e4f5f47397940c66d641c7f55e OP_EQUAL
address
M8WD2pY7XugTeEigqUDda72NBviGYT4iQX
transaction
85587c25cb2095b9a1ce53fb5810944b8c6be4dcf23ba3dcd91fc589b14af965
spent
true